Context
In this narration, Mu'awiyah inquires about the practice of the Prophet Muhammad (ﷺ) regarding the two 'Eids, and Zaid bin Arqam confirms that the Prophet prayed the 'Eid prayer early in the day and then permitted a concession regarding the Friday prayer. This highlights the flexibility and understanding in Islamic practices, especially during significant occasions.
